The RAF's upgraded BAE Systems Harrier GR.9 prototype development aircraft (ZD320), a follow-on to GR.7/7A ground-attack fighter, made its initial flight from Warton in Lancashire, on May 30.
The U.K. government intends to procure the Maverick missile system from Raytheon Co. for the Harrier GR7, following successful completion of tests, the company said yesterday.
